What is Lactobacillus casei, and why is it beneficial?

Lactobacillus casei is a beneficial bacterium with a storied history, first identified in cheese and now widely recognized for its probiotic properties. Officially known since 2020 as Lacticaseibacillus casei, it's a member of the Lactobacillus group and is renowned for its resilience, surviving the harsh conditions of the gastrointestinal tract to deliver therapeutic effects. It accomplishes this by producing lactic acid, which helps create an environment hostile to pathogenic microorganisms while supporting beneficial gut flora.

Digestive health benefits

One of the most significant uses of Lactobacillus casei is in addressing a variety of digestive issues. Its ability to restore balance to the gut microbiome makes it a popular choice for treating conditions exacerbated by microbial imbalance.

  • Diarrhea management: Numerous studies support its effectiveness in preventing or reducing the duration of different types of diarrhea. This includes infectious diarrhea, traveler's diarrhea, and antibiotic-associated diarrhea. For example, one clinical trial demonstrated that a probiotic drink containing L. casei could significantly lower the incidence of antibiotic-associated and C. difficile-associated diarrhea in elderly hospital patients.
  • Constipation relief: Specific strains, such as Lactobacillus casei Shirota (LcS), have been shown to improve symptoms of chronic constipation. Studies indicate that daily intake can significantly reduce colonic transit time, leading to more regular and softer stools. This is thought to be mediated by the production of short-chain fatty acids (SCFAs) that stimulate colonic motility.
  • Irritable Bowel Syndrome (IBS): L. casei can help alleviate some of the symptoms associated with IBS, such as abdominal pain and bloating, by improving overall gut function and microbiota balance.

Immune system modulation

The gut is a crucial part of the body's immune system, and L. casei plays a direct role in modulating this response. It supports a balanced immune function rather than an overactive one, which is beneficial for managing inflammatory conditions and fighting infections.

  • Enhancing innate immunity: It stimulates essential immune cells, including natural killer cells, and boosts the production of secretory immunoglobulin A (sIgA), an antibody vital for mucosal immunity in the gut. Studies in children with acute diarrhea showed that L. casei supplementation increased fecal IgA and reduced inflammatory markers.
  • Anti-inflammatory effects: Some strains exhibit anti-inflammatory properties, which can help manage gut inflammation. One study found that a specific strain, L. casei LH23, could ameliorate colitis in mice by decreasing inflammatory cytokines and restoring protective histone modifications.

Applications in functional foods and beyond

Beyond supplements, L. casei is extensively used in the food industry for its fermenting and preserving qualities.

  • Fermented dairy products: It is a key ingredient in many yogurts and fermented milk products, where it contributes to flavor, texture, and probiotic content. Its hardiness makes it well-suited for commercial production and long shelf life.
  • Natural preservative: L. casei produces bacteriocins, which are compounds that inhibit the growth of harmful bacteria and molds, acting as a natural preservative in foods.
  • Sustainable biotechnology: In a push for more sustainable practices, L. casei is being used in biotechnology to ferment food waste into valuable products like lactic acid, which is used in biodegradable plastics and pharmaceuticals.

Potential risks and strain-specific effects

While generally considered safe for most people, some considerations are important, especially regarding the strain-specific nature of probiotics.

  • Side effects: Mild side effects such as gas or bloating may occur, especially when first starting supplementation, as the gut adjusts.
  • At-risk groups: For individuals with compromised immune systems, such as those undergoing chemotherapy, there is a very rare risk of infection. It is crucial for these individuals to consult a healthcare provider before use.
  • Strain matters: The specific health benefit depends heavily on the strain of L. casei used. For instance, L. casei Shirota has been widely studied for constipation and immunity, while other strains might have different effects. The efficacy shown in one study with a particular strain cannot be assumed for all products containing L. casei.
